On Mon, 2003-06-23 at 16:15, Con Kolivas wrote:

> For those who aren't familiar, you've utilised the secret desktop weapon:
> 
> +		if (!(p->time_slice % MIN_TIMESLICE) &&
> 
> This is not how Ingo intended it. This is my desktop bastardising of the 
> patch. It was originally about 50ms (timeslice granularity). This changes it 
> to 10ms which means all running tasks round robin every 10ms - this is what I 
> use in -ck and is great for a desktop but most probably of detriment 
> elsewhere. Having said that, it does nice things to desktops :-)

I lost the track to Ingo's patch sometime ago, so I borrowed it from
your latest patchset ;-) It does really nice things on desktops. It
brings 2.5 to a new life on my 700Mhz laptop.

What impact would have increasing MIN_TIMESLICE from 10 to, let's say,
50?
